VS代码如何将未使用的变量显示为红色

VS code how to show unused variables as red

我的编辑器设置为未使用的导入和变量启用了灰色:"editor.showUnused": true

但是我怎样才能改变它而不是灰色,而不是灰色的线条有红色背景?

这是一个 Javascript 文件。

据我所知,这个选项似乎已从 1.25 版本中删除。

请参考:Improve color name editorUnnecessary.foreground

在为色盲同事编写 Visual Studio 代码 (v1.38.0) settings.json 时,我发现此设置很成功:

"workbench.colorCustomizations": {
  "editorUnnecessaryCode.border": "#dd7aab"
},

^ 设置并不能完全解决您对红色背景的需求,但它确实提供了一种替代方案,有助于突出未使用的项目。这就是我们的样子:

仅供参考:我在尝试以下设置时遇到了失败:

editorUnnecessary.foreground
editorUnnecessaryCode.foreground

"workbench.colorCustomizations": {
  "editorUnnecessary.foreground": "#dd7aab"
}

"workbench.colorCustomizations": {
  "editorUnnecessaryCode.foreground": "#dd7aab"
}

VSCode 团队需要完成未使用(不必要)代码主题化的计划和文档。

第 1 步: 打开 Settings 页面。

  • 点击 File。它将打开文件菜单。
  • Click/Hover Preferences。它将打开首选项菜单。
  • 单击 Settings 选项。它将打开设置页面。

第 2 步: 打开 settings.json.

  • 在设置页面上,单击 Appearance 选项卡。它将显示 Appearance 个选项。
  • 在里面检查 Color Customizations 选项。它将有 link Edit in settings.json。点击 link.
  • 它将打开settings.json

第 3 步:更新设置。

  • 使用editorUnnecessaryCode.border更新不必要代码的边框颜色。
"workbench.colorCustomizations": {
   "editorUnnecessaryCode.border": "#ff0000"
 }